WOMAN
"SHOCKING RECORD"
REVEALED
MAY BE SENT TO
SESSIONS
A Chinese woman, was robbed of $60 by a Eurasian who tricked her at the General Post Office on Wednesday.
he
one of the In connection with the affair, Douglas Gifford, 38, unemployed. of Hongkong, appeared before Mr. Wynne-Jones in the Central Police Court this morning, when pleaded guilty to the charge.
Detective-Insn. Murphy said the complainant, a married woman, received a postal order from her husband for $60. At the Post Office she met the defendant, who after she had received the money. over the numbers on the notes. suggested going upstairs to check She complied, and after checking. Gifford disappeared.

Gifford's previous convictions, which he admitted, were read out by the magistrate. They were:- 1920 three months, 1930 twelve months, 1991 nine months, all for theft by false pretences.
Magistrate I don't think the maximum sentence which I can give. six months. is sufficient. I think I ought to commit him, in view of his shocking record. This man is a danger to the community.
Gifford
remanded Tuesday afternoon. Mr. Wynne- Jones remarking-I shall consider whether I will commit you or not.
